SERVER
POSITION DESCRIPTION
Full time (seasonal)
The Server is responsible for giving exceptional service to the members and guests in all Food and
Beverage outlets. This position requires a positive personality and attitude, a flexible work schedule, and excellent customer service skills.
- Greet and seat guests
- Use of a POS (point of sale) System frequently
- Maintain order and cleanliness in all F&B outlets
- Assure that member satisfaction standards are consistently attained
- Create a desirable dining atmosphere through attitude, appearance, and knowledgeable service
- Ability to learn the golf course quickly
- Be flexible and willing to help in all facets of the operation as directed by the managerial staff
- Ensure a high level of customer service is performed
Skills
- Attention to detail
- Having a flexible schedule. 40-hour work week and available on weekends, holidays, early mornings, late evenings, and overtime
- Comfortable with standing for long periods of time
- Ability to lift objects usually 50 lbs or less
- Ability to work in a group environment
- Willing to work in a variety of outdoor conditions throughout the season
Education/Experience
- Any persons over the age of 18 and has a valid Driver’s License
- Those applying for busser positions may be 16+
- Must have or plan to obtain an ABC license
- Serving experience preferred but not required
- Applicants with bartending experience are highly considered for hiring
- Hourly rate (based on experience) + commission. $14-20/hour.
- Compensation package also includes team uniforms, an employee appreciation fund (end of season), scholarship opportunities, and meals while on duty.
